That the Poor May Be Exalted

In 1935, Mormon fundamentalists outlined a vision for their community based on the United Order, a nineteenth-century Mormon communitarian program based on consecration and tithing. Joseph White Musser’s theology of communitarianism manifested in the founding of Short Creek, a section of land on the border between Utah and Arizona that is the historic home to the Mormon fundamentalist movement and synonymous with the faith. This chapter contextualizes the emergence of Short Creek during the Great Depression. During economic turmoil and loss of social safety nets, the community became a source of hope for disenfranchised polygamists and a way to solidify the movement into a united body of believers.
